Protecting Your Innovations: Understanding Intellectual Property
Securing your inventive creations is essential for success in today's evolving marketplace. Understanding intellectual property is not simply a matter for large corporations ; it’s becoming necessary for startups and solo inventors alike. Intellectual property includes a variety of legal entitlements, including:
- Patents: provide sole license to produce an innovation.
- Copyrights: cover original works of creation , like music.
- Trademarks: differentiate your services from the ones of rivals.
- Trade Secrets: permit you to maintain private data that offers you a business advantage .
Proactive consideration and appropriate registration are vital to realizing the potential value of your proprietary assets.
Income Tax Filing Made Easy: Tips & Common Mistakes
Filing your yearly income tax can feel like a complicated job, but it doesn't must not be that way! This guide offers simple tips to streamline the process and avoid costly blunders. Here's a quick look at how to tackle your responsibilities and what traps to watch out for.
Here are a few essential tips:
- Collect all relevant documents, including pay stubs, independent income reports, and receipts for expenses.
- Choose the appropriate filing classification (e.g., individual, married filing as a couple, head of household).
- Think about using online filing or getting the guidance of a qualified accountant.
Common oversights to steer clear of include: omitting to claim available deductions, entering wrong income, and omitting to approve the return. Verify everything meticulously before filing it to the government to reduce potential penalties and ensure an correct filing.
